If the dealer service damaged it, they should do what it takes to put the Mo back to the condition it was prior to their actions. Best bet is to insist on a new one. Even if the bumper is fine cosmetically, it was designed to absorb impacts through a collapsible foam under the bumper cover. If there was enough force to damage the outside, there was definitely damage to the inside. the dealer service should remove the bumper cover, ensure that all internals are undamaged or replaced and then put on a new bumper cover complete with matching paint.
